Seagrams Royal Stag Blended Whisky

Seagram's Royal Stag Blended Whisky is a popular alcoholic drink in India. It was launched in 1995 by Seagram, a renowned name in the spirits industry. The whisky is known for its smooth taste and quality blend, making it a favourite among whisky lovers. Seagram's Royal Stag Blended Whisky originated in India. It was introduced to the market in 1995. The brand quickly gained popularity due to its Read more...unique blend of Indian grain spirits and imported Scotch malts.Read Less

Ingredients

The main ingredients of Seagram's Royal Stag Blended Whisky include Indian grain spirits and Scotch malts. These ingredients are carefully selected to ensure a high-quality blend.

Preparation

The preparation of Seagram's Royal Stag involves blending Indian grain spirits with Scotch malts. The blend is then aged in oak barrels to develop its distinct flavour.

Flavour Profile

Seagram's Royal Stag Blended Whisky has a smooth and rich flavour. It features notes of vanilla, caramel, and oak. The whisky has a balanced taste with a hint of smokiness.

Variations

Seagram's Royal Stag offers several variations. These include the classic Royal Stag, Royal Stag Barrel Select, and Royal Stag Mega Music CDs. Each variation has its unique taste and appeal.

Cultural Significance

In India, Seagram's Royal Stag Blended Whisky holds cultural significance. It is often enjoyed during celebrations and social gatherings. The brand is also associated with music and sports events.

Pairings

Seagram's Royal Stag pairs well with various foods. Popular pairings include grilled meats, spicy Indian dishes, and cheese platters. The whisky's rich flavour complements these foods perfectly.

Serving Suggestions

Seagram's Royal Stag can be enjoyed neat, on the rocks, or with a splash of water. It can also be used as a base for cocktails like whisky sour or old fashioned.

Popularity and Trends

The popularity of Seagram's Royal Stag has grown over the years. It is now one of the leading whisky brands in India. The brand continues to attract new consumers with its quality and taste.

Interesting Facts

Seagram's Royal Stag was the first brand in India to not use artificial flavours or colours. The brand has also won several awards for its quality and taste.

Cocktail Recipes

Cocktail NameIngredientsPreparation Method
Whisky Sour60ml Royal Stag, 30ml lemon juice, 15ml sugar syrupShake ingredients with ice, strain into glass
Old Fashioned60ml Royal Stag, 1 sugar cube, 3 dashes bittersMuddle sugar with bitters, add whisky and ice, stir well
Mint Julep60ml Royal Stag, 4 mint leaves, 15ml sugar syrupMuddle mint leaves with sugar syrup, add whisky and ice, stir well
